WebTo apply for PIP, you need to contact the Department for Work and Pensions (DWP). You can do this by: post phone textphone Relay UK a video relay service PIP: Contacting the DWP about a claim (GOV.UK) It can take months to complete the PIP process: contacting the DWP about a claim filling in your PIP claim form and getting evidence

WebThe first stage of appealing a DWP decision is mandatory reconsideration. Benefits that have mandatory reconsideration include: Personal Independence Payment (PIP) Disability Living Allowance (DLA) Attendance Allowance (AA) Employment and Support Allowance (ESA), either contribution or income-related Universal Credit (UC) Carer’s Allowance (CA)
